Reuben Gabriel Scores First - Ever Goal In Europe, Igiebor Shines In Maccabi Tel Aviv Win
Published: January 18, 2016
Nigeria international midfielders Nosa Igiebor and Reuben Gabriel helped their teams record wins in their respective leagues on Monday night.
Nosa Igibeor scored his second goal in the Israeli Premier League as Maccabi Tel Aviv thrashed Hapoel Acre 3 - 0 on match day 19.
The former Dream Team star gave the champions a two - goal advantage 20 minutes from time when he capitalized on a defensive error to slot in past Daniel Amos.
In Portugal, former Kano Pillars star Reuben Gabriel netted his first - ever goal since he moved to Europe in 2013 in Boavista’s 4 - 0 annihilation of Vitória Setúbal in the Prmieira Liga.
Gabriel, who hit target in the 52nd minute, went the distance while Michael Uchebo watched proceedings from the bench .
